        What are Cheek Fillers?

        As you age, it’s common for your cheeks to lose their natural volume and definition. Dermal cheek fillers can remedy those issues and help you achieve a more youthful-looking appearance. A minimally invasive aesthetic treatment, dermal cheek fillers are cosmetic injectables that plump your structure and reduce fine lines and wrinkles. It’s a common way to combat signs of aging and give yourself a well-deserved boost of confidence.

        How Long Does It Take to Recover from a Cheek Filler Procedure?

        Since this is a minimally invasive procedure, downtime is minimal; you’re welcome to resume your daily activities as planned, provided that you don’t experience any side effects that bring you discomfort (such as minor bruising and swelling). To expedite your recovery time and maximize your results, we advise that you avoid touching or rubbing the injection areas, don’t smoke, stay out of the sun, and refrain from strenuous exercise and excessive alcohol consumption 48 hours following your treatment.

        How Long Do Cheek Fillers Last?
        Your dermal cheek fillers are designed to last between 10 months to a year. Some fillers last longer than a year, but your results will vary based on individual factors, including the type of fillers used, your body’s natural aging process, and whether you smoke or spend a lot of time in the sun.         How to Prepare for a Cheek Filler Treatment

        We strive to make your cheek filler treatment at Skin Matters a pleasant experience from start to finish. To ensure that your cheek fillers produce the desired results, we ask that you discontinue blood-thinning medications two weeks before your scheduled appointment.

        Eat a healthy, well-balanced diet and drink lots of water in the days leading up to your procedure. Avoiding alcohol consumption 24 hours before your appointment is also important because alcohol can increase the likelihood of experiencing swelling or bruising post-injection.

        Cheek Filler Aftercare

        After you receive your cheek filler injections, you’ll likely be able to go about your day as planned. However, you may have some bruising and/or swelling; if these or other mild symptoms are causing you discomfort, we recommend applying cold compresses. You should limit sun exposure, avoid rubbing or excessively touching your injection sites, refrain from using make-up or lotions for the remainder of the day, and sleep on your back that night.

        What age is ideal for cheek fillers?

        As you age, your skin loses its elasticity, especially as collagen production decreases (this is why collagen-stimulating treatments such as Sculptra continue to gain popularity). We find that some people get cheek fillers in their 30s and 40s to address early signs of aging, while some people wait until they are past the age of 50 to get this type of injectable. There’s no right or wrong answer regarding the ideal age to pursue cheek fillers because it comes down to your personal preference.

        Is 1 syringe of cheek filler a lot?

        On average, 1 syringe of cheek filler is not a lot - it equates to the size of a blueberry- but for some patients, 1 syringe is enough to produce the desired results. A few syringes will likely be necessary for patients who have lost a sizeable amount of volume and definition in their cheeks and cheekbones. The type of filler used also influences this answer because some serums are thicker while others are thinner. Your medical aesthetician can accurately determine how many syringes will be necessary during your treatment session.

        Does cheek filler make your face rounder?

        Dermal cheek fillers should not make your face rounder, but this can occur if an experienced medical aesthetician does not strategically inject the fillers. Using too much filler, for instance, could add unnecessary volume. Our goal at Skin Matters in Vancouver is not to alter your face shape but to enhance and restore the natural contours of your cheeks.  

        Can fillers fix sagging cheeks?

        Dermal cheek fillers address mild to moderate sagging cheeks. This treatment, however, might not be ideal for individuals with severe cases of sagging cheeks, and alternative approaches might need to be considered instead.
